Official, verified software for Kodak TVs (manufactured under license by Super Plastronics Pvt. Ltd. in regions like India) is primarily distributed through the TV's built-in system update interface rather than direct public download links for manual flashing. How to Download and Install Verified Updates

The safest way to get verified software is through the Over-the-Air (OTA) update system on your TV:

Open Settings: Use your remote to navigate to the Settings (gear icon) in the top right corner of the home screen. kodak tv software verified download

Navigate to System Info: Go to Device Preferences and then select About. Check for Updates: Select System Update or Network Update.

Download & Install: If a verified update is found, click Download. Once finished, select Restart to complete the installation. Critical Support Information

Manual Downloads: Be cautious of third-party "Stock ROM" sites or YouTube links providing .bin or .zip files. Installing unverified firmware can "brick" your TV. If your TV will not boot and you require a manual flash file, contact Kodak TV India Support directly to request the specific firmware for your model.

To get your TV back to its best performance, you can follow these official and verified paths: 1. The Automatic Path (Over-the-Air)

Most Kodak Smart TVs are designed to update themselves through the internet. This is the safest way to ensure you are getting a verified build directly from the manufacturer.

Step 1: Grab your remote and head to Settings (usually a gear icon in the top right). Step 2: Select Device Preferences and then click on About. Step 3: Choose System Update.

Step 4: If a verified update is waiting, click Download. Once it hits 100%, select Restart Now to finalize the installation. 2. The Manual Path (USB Update)

If your TV isn't connecting to the internet, you can perform a manual "side-load" using a USB drive.

Find Your Source: For Kodak TVs in India, the verified source for drivers and support is Kodak TV India. For general consumer electronics, you can check the main Kodak Support Portal.

Prepare the Drive: Format a USB drive to FAT32. Download the official firmware file (often named upgrade_loader.pkg) and place it in the root directory—do not put it inside any folders.

The Installation: Plug the drive into the TV while it is in standby. Press and hold the physical Power Button on the TV (not the remote) for 5–7 seconds until the LED starts blinking.
